Privacy-preserving routing is crucial for some ad hoc networks that require stronger privacy protection. A number of schemes have been proposed to protect privacy in ad hoc networks. However, none of these schemes offer complete unlinkability or unobservability property since data packets and control packets are still linkable and distinguishable in these schemes. In this paper, we define stronger privacy requirements regarding privacy-preserving routing in mobile ad hoc networks. Then we propose AODV to offer complete unlinkability and content unobservability effectively for all types of packets. AODV is efficient as it uses a novel combination of group signature and ID-based encryption for route discovery. Security analysis demonstrates that AODV can well protect user privacy against both inside and outside attackers. We implement AODV on ns2,thus the proposed system is to detect and prevent the wormhole attacks in MANET using path tracing.